Canadian artist and songwriter Olivia Lunny is one of the most promising rising stars in music today, delivering her own distinct flavor of pop through candid and thoughtful lyrics, accompanied flawlessly by dance infused synths and bright, stunning vocals.
After taking up guitar and writing her first song at the age of 12, the Winnipeg native soon ascended to national fame, earning a Western Canadian Music Award nomination for Pop Artist of the Year when she was 17 and scoring a Top 40 hit in 2019 with her magnetic single “I Got You.” More recently, Olivia had the honor performing with some of Canada ’s top musical talent including Justin Bieber and Michael Bublé, on a charity cover of "Lean On Me" to raise funds for the Canadian Red Cross towards COVID19 relief efforts and initiatives, and with early features from outlets including Billboard, PAPER, American Songwriter, and Parade, Olivia’s refreshing new pop sound is already making major waves.
Olivia's new EP, ‘To the Ones I Loved’ captures the playfulness, vulnerability, and energy of navigating the transition from her teenage years into young adulthood. The project is a reflection of Olivia’s journey so far and the thoughtful lyrics in each song both challenge the listener to embrace the multifaceted emotions that come with heartbreak while providing the comforting reassurance that growth will inevitably come from those experiences.
